FINISH 1™ BED LINER – FL910P
Finish 1 Bed Liner is a high performing Polyurethane coating that offers a long lasting, durable finish. The Bed Liner guards against gas, oil, chemicals and solvents. The product protects surface from impacts and scratches. In addition, the Bed Liner is easy to apply on truck beds, trailers, ramps, wheel wells, equipment and various other surfaces.

SANDING/CLEANING

Painted Surfaces should be cleaned with detergent and water. Rinse surface with clean water and allow
to dry thoroughly. Remove any excess grease/oil with FT200, then wipe surface with clean rag. Scuff
sand with 180-grit sandpaper. Clean the surface and remove all sanding residue with FT200.


Bare Metal Surfaces should be free of any excess grease/oil using FT200, then wipe surface with clean
rag. Scuff sand the surface with 180-grit sandpaper. Clean the surface and remove all sanding residue
with FT200. Prime bare metal with FP301 or equivalent. Follow all application guidelines of etch primer
before proceeding with Bed Liner application.



APPLICATION
Apply product with a Schutz style (such as Dupli-Color™ DCTRG102) spray gun.  Spray pressure at the gun should be set to 40-45 psi. The fluid hose length should not exceed 24”.

Step 1: Apply a double coat, wet-on-wet, 8” from surface.
-Flash for 10-15 minutes (If longer than 30 minutes elapses, scuff sanding is required before applying another coat)
Step 2: Apply another double coat, wet-on-wet, 8” – 4’ from surface*

*Final texture is dependent on distance of spray gun from surface. Greater distance will give rougher texture.
Note: Minimum wet film build is 20 mils in order to achieve uniform appearance.

 
DRYING SCHEDULE
Baking: 45 minutes at 140°F (full cure in three days). 

Any reassembly can occur after bake and cool down.  Adjacent edges (tailgate to bed) can be separated with SHIELD Masking Paper after 60 minutes when the tailgate is closed.  Separation with masking paper should be done until product is fully cured.

Air Dry: Overnight at 70°F (full cure in five days).

Adjacent edges (tailgate to bed) can be separated with SHIELD Masking Paper after 60 minutes when the tailgate is closed. Separation with masking paper should be done until product is fully cured.
